Suzzanne

Another double-z variant of Suzanne that emphasizes distinctiveness while preserving the classic Hebrew 'lily' meaning and French elegance. This spelling emerged in 20th-century America as parents sought to personalize traditional names. The double-z creates visual and sonic prominence without altering the name's fundamental character.
